As used in this Act: "Administering State agency" means any agency or department of the State that is eligible to receive a direct federal allocation of federal Emergency Rental Assistance funds that will disburse funds and administer all or a portion of the federal Emergency Rental Assistance Program. "Applicant" or "program applicant" means any person or entity who is a residential tenant or lessee or landlord or lessor that has submitted an application, individually or jointly, to receive federal Emergency Rental Assistance funds. "Eligible household" has the same meaning as used by the federal law enacting the federal Emergency Rental Assistance Program. "Program" means the federal Emergency Rental Assistance Program.
